Have you tried using a format command in your sql string?
Not sure on your database flavor but is very common to format the date as needed 
during the select.

ie; 
select FORMAT([date],'mm/dd/yyyy') as Dateformatted

> I'm having a real problem with retrieving the results I want with sambar 
> scripting. I have been through 3 turotials and none have been any help so 
> I'm hoping someone here has an idea for me.
> 
> In a nutshell I'm grouping byte counts on a daily basis from a table. The 
> querry below does what it should but the date format comes out 20030121 
> not a pretty 2003/01/21 if I remove the left() I get the full date time 
> which I don't want either.
> 
> <RCQmylog sql="select left(tstamp,10),sum(bytes) from RC$tbl group by left
> (tstamp,10);">
> <RCwhile RCFmylog = 1>
> <b>Traffic on:</b> <RCDmylog.1> - <i><RCDmylog.2></i> bytes<br>
> <RCendwhile
